วีดีโอ: จะเกิดอะไรขึ้นเมื่ออินเตอร์รัปต์เกิดขึ้นในไมโครโปรเซสเซอร์?
2024 ผู้เขียน: Lynn Donovan | [email protected]. แก้ไขล่าสุด: 2023-12-15 23:54
หนึ่ง ขัดจังหวะ เป็นภาวะที่ทำให้ ไมโครโปรเซสเซอร์ถึง ทำงานอื่นชั่วคราว แล้วค่อยกลับมา ถึง งานก่อนหน้าของมัน อินเตอร์รัปต์สามารถ เป็นภายในหรือภายนอก สังเกตว่าเมื่อ ขัดจังหวะ (อินท์) เกิดขึ้น , โปรแกรมหยุดทำงานและไมโครคอนโทรลเลอร์เริ่มทำงาน ถึง ดำเนินการ ISR
ในทำนองเดียวกันจะถามว่าเกิดอะไรขึ้นเมื่อมีการขัดจังหวะ?
เมื่อ เกิดการขัดจังหวะ , มัน ทำให้ CPU หยุดรันโปรแกรมปัจจุบัน เมื่อ ขัดจังหวะ ถูกสร้างขึ้น ตัวประมวลผลจะบันทึกสถานะการดำเนินการผ่านสวิตช์บริบท และเริ่มดำเนินการ ขัดจังหวะ ผู้จัดการที่ ขัดจังหวะ เวกเตอร์
ในทำนองเดียวกันอินเตอร์รัปต์และประเภทของไมโครโปรเซสเซอร์คืออะไร? อินเตอร์รัปต์ เป็น NS สัญญาณที่สร้างขึ้นโดย NS อุปกรณ์ภายนอกที่จะร้องขอ ไมโครโปรเซสเซอร์ เพื่อปฏิบัติงาน มี5 ขัดจังหวะ สัญญาณ เช่น TRAP, RST 7.5, RST 6.5, RST 5.5 และ INTR เวกเตอร์ ขัดจังหวะ − ในนี้ พิมพ์ ของ ขัดจังหวะ , การขัดจังหวะ ที่อยู่เป็นที่รู้จัก NS โปรเซสเซอร์ ตัวอย่างเช่น: RST7
นอกจากนี้ จะเกิดอะไรขึ้นเมื่ออินเตอร์รัปต์ใน 8085?
อินเทล 8085 ขัดจังหวะ ขั้นตอนกระบวนการเป็นหลัก: หน่วย I/O ออกและ ขัดจังหวะ ส่งสัญญาณไปยังซีพียู CPU ดำเนินการคำสั่งปัจจุบันเสร็จสิ้นก่อนที่จะตอบสนอง ตอนนี้ CPU จะโหลดพีซี (ตัวนับโปรแกรม) ด้วยตำแหน่งของ ISR และดึงคำแนะนำ ถ่ายโอนการควบคุมไปยัง ขัดจังหวะ ตัวจัดการ
จุดประสงค์ของการขัดจังหวะคืออะไร?
บทบาทของ อินเตอร์รัปต์ . อินเตอร์รัปต์ เป็นสัญญาณที่ส่งไปยัง CPU โดยอุปกรณ์ภายนอก โดยปกติอุปกรณ์ I/O พวกเขาบอกให้ CPU หยุดกิจกรรมปัจจุบันและดำเนินการส่วนที่เหมาะสมของระบบปฏิบัติการ